docker 鏡像托管平臺用于管理和存儲 docker 鏡像,方便開發者和用戶訪問和使用預構建的軟件環境。常見的平臺包括:docker hub:由 docker 官方維護,擁有龐大的鏡像庫。github container registry:集成了 github 生態系統。google container registry:由 google cloud platform 托管。amazon elastic container registry:由 aws 托管。quay.io:由 red hat
Docker 鏡像托管平臺
Docker 鏡像托管平臺用于管理和存儲 Docker 鏡像,使開發人員和用戶可以輕松訪問和使用預構建的軟件環境。
Docker Hub
Docker Hub 是 Docker 官方維護的公共鏡像托管平臺。它是 Docker 鏡像的中央存儲庫,提供了一個易于發現、下載和共享鏡像的地方。Docker Hub 包含數百萬個由 Docker、社區和第三方供應商提供的鏡像。
優點:
- 官方維護:由 Docker 維護,保證了穩定性和可靠性。
- 龐大的鏡像庫:擁有大量的預構建鏡像,可滿足各種需求。
- 易于訪問:可以通過 Docker CLI、http API 或 GUI 訪問。
- 社區支持:擁有活躍的社區論壇,提供技術支持和協作。
其他公共鏡像托管平臺
除了 Docker Hub,還有其他一些公共鏡像托管平臺可供使用:
- gitHub Container Registry:集成了 github 生態系統,用于存儲和管理 Docker 鏡像。
- Google Container Registry:由 Google Cloud Platform 托管,提供安全、可擴展的鏡像存儲。
- Amazon Elastic Container Registry:由 AWS 托管,專為在 AWS 上運行的容器優化。
- Quay.io:由 Red Hat 維護,提供企業級鏡像管理解決方案。
選擇平臺
選擇合適的鏡像托管平臺取決于具體的需要和偏好。以下因素可能有助于做出決定:
- 功能:平臺提供的功能和特性,例如鏡像版本控制、安全掃描和自動化。
- 易用性:界面和 API 的易用性。
- 生態系統支持:平臺與其他開發工具和服務集成的程度。
- 定價:平臺的定價模式和是否提供免費層或有限層。